Moschino(Italian pronunciation:[moˈskiːno]) is an Italianluxuryfashion housefounded in 1983 byFranco MoschinoinMilan[2]known for over-the-top,campydesigns.[3]The company specializes in ready-to-wear, handbags, and fashion accessories.[2] Moschino's creative director is Adrian Appiolaza.[4][5]
History[edit]
Founding and 1990s[edit]
Franco Moschino was born on 27 February 1950 and raised inAbbiategrasso,Italy.[6]Moschino studied atAccademia di Bellein Milan from 1968 to 1971, at the dismay of his father, who hoped Franco would continue his family's work in the iron industry. While a student, Franco freelanced designs and illustrations for magazines and fashion houses. Upon graduation, Franco worked as a design sketcher forVersacefrom 1971 to 1977 and designed for Italian fashion house Cadette until 1982.[7]The following year, Franco created "Moschino Couture!",[8]owned by Moonshadow, its Milan-based holding company.[6]Franco gained a reputation for implementing innovative, colorful, and witty designs into his apparel,[7]such incorporating aRoy Lichtensteinpop artpiece in a suit[9]and designing a t-shirt featuring a TV tuned to “Channel No. 5" (sparking a lawsuit byChaneldue to the reference to itsChanel No. 5perfume).[6]
By the late 1980s, Moschino's popularity in Europe had begun to replicate in the United States, with US sales accounting for 15 to 20 percent of business.[6]By the 1990s, Franco became known for his social awareness campaigns and his criticism of the fashion industry.[7]In 1994, Franco expressed desire to develop an ecological line “Nature Friendly Garment”,[6]however Franco died later that year fromHIV/AIDS-related causes.[10]In recent times, Moschino has made an effort to combat theHIV/AIDS epidemicthrough a partnership withProduct RedandNickelodeon,creating a Moschino xSpongeBobcollection, bringing awareness to HIV/AIDS and fundraising by donating the collection's proceeds to Project Red.[11]
Rossella Jardini, 1994–2013[edit]
After Franco's death in 1994, his friendRossella Jardinibecame the brand's creative director. Responsible for the brand's image and style, Jardini's whimsical designs fit in nicely with the brand's established eccentricity.[10]While Jardini was creative director, Moschino created outfits and accessories for artistsMadonna[12]andLady Gaga[13]for their world tours and created the opening ceremony outfits for the2006 Winter Olympics.[14]In 2009, Moschino opened its hotel concept, Maison Moschino.[15]
In 1999, Moschino joined Aeffe S.p.A., an Italian group.[16]
With the F/W 2008–2009 pre-collection, Moschino Jeans changed its name to Love Moschino.[17]
Jeremy Scott, 2013–2023[edit]
![McDonald's-inspired dress from Moschino Fall 2014](https://upload.wikimedia.org/wikipedia/commons/thumb/5/50/Camp_-_Notes_on_Fashion_at_the_Met_-_Moschino_%2873834%29.jpg/170px-Camp_-_Notes_on_Fashion_at_the_Met_-_Moschino_%2873834%29.jpg)
In October 2013,Jeremy Scottbecame Moschino's creative director, debuting his first collection in Fall 2014.[19]Starting in 2014 under Scott's direction, Moschino Cheap and Chic was consolidated into a new women's line— "Boutique Moschino" —established to target a wider array of costumers, with a price-point about 40 percent lower than Moschino's mainline.[20]
![Madonna wearing a Moschino black one-piece outfit with fringe and Swarovski crystals during her Rebel Heart Tour](https://upload.wikimedia.org/wikipedia/commons/thumb/6/6c/Madonna_-_Rebel_Heart_Tour_Cologne_2_%2822851595377%29.jpg/170px-Madonna_-_Rebel_Heart_Tour_Cologne_2_%2822851595377%29.jpg)
In 2014, Scott designed a smiley face themed outfit forKaty Perry's world tour[22]and in 2015 designed a black one-piece outfit with Swarovski crystals for Madonna's world tour.[21]
In April 2018, Moschino announced a collaboration withH&M.[23]The following year, Moschino collaborated withEA Gamesfor aSims 4collection. The collection featured clothing with pixelated illusions inspired by the computer game.[24]
With the 2019Met Gala's themeCamp:Notes on Fashion, Katy Perry wore a gown that looked like a chandelier, created by Moschino, andKacey Musgravesarrived appearing like a life-sizeBarbie,also by Moschino.[25]
In 2021, Aeffe S.p.A. gained full control of Moschino, by acquiring the remaining 30 percent stake it did not originally own, at the price of 66.6 million euros ($78.51 million).[26][1]
In March 2023, Scott announced his exit from the creative director position.[27]
Davide Renne, 2023[edit]
In October 2023, Aeffe announcedDavide Renneas the new creative director of Moschino, overseeing the women's and men's lines and accessories. He joined Moschino after a 20-year career atGucci.[28][29]He assumed the role on 1 November, but died from a suspected heart attack in Milan nine days later, at the age of 46.[28]
Adrian Appiolaza, 2024–present[edit]
In January 2024, Adrian Appiolaza was appointed as the new creative director of Moschino.[30]Prior to his appointment, Appiolaza worked atLoewefor 10 years as womenswear design director underJonathan Anderson.[30]Appiolaza is a graduate ofCentral Saint Martinsand has also worked atChloé,Alexander McQueen,andMiu Miu.[31]
Controversy[edit]
In a 2015 lawsuit, New York-based graffiti artist Rime claimed the Moschino dress worn by Katy Perry at the2015 Met Galacopied his work.[32]The case was settled in 2016.[33]
In 2016,Nordstromresponded to pressure from consumers and pulled Moschino's pill-themed merchandise from its shelves, amid allegations it trivialized theopioid epidemic.[34][35]
Philanthropy[edit]
For its fashion show in Milan in September 2023, Moschino showed its solidarity with theElton John AIDS Foundation,founded byElton John,which works to help and support people affected by HIV.[36]
